The Asthma Score in 83815, Coeur D Alene, Idaho is 49 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.
89.05 percent of the population in 83815 drive to work alone. 1.02 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 79.66 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 1.96 percent of the residents in 83815 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.37 members with about 2.24 cars available per household.
An estimate of 89.52 percent of the residents in 83815 has some form of health insurance. 35.81 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 68.82 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 83815 would have to travel an average of 2.91 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Kootenai Health .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 83815, Coeur D Alene, Idaho.

As of , an estimate of 36,987 residents live in 83815 with a median age of 39.9 years. 23.51 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 19.28 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 35.78 percent of the residents in 83815 is currently married, and 20.14 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 83815 is $6,298.58.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 83815 is approximately $1,108. The median household spends about 17.59 percent of their income on housing.

Asthma is a chronic respiratory condition that affects the airways, causing symptoms such as wheezing, shortness of breath, chest tightness, and coughing. Managing Asthma requires ongoing medical care, including regular check-ups with healthcare providers, access to prescription medications, and prompt treatment during exacerbations.

Local History & Community Appeal
Beyond its healthcare amenities, the 83815 ZIP Code area boasts a rich history that adds cultural depth and community appeal for potential movers. Coeur D Alene has evolved from its origins as a hub for mining and timber industries into a vibrant city known for its outdoor recreation opportunities including hiking trails, water sports activities on Lake Coeur d'Alene as well as world-class golf courses.
This blend of historical significance coupled with modern amenities makes Coeur D Alene an attractive destination for those seeking both natural beauty and urban convenience. The area's strong sense of community is evident through events such as the annual Ironman Triathlon competition which draws athletes from around the world as well as local festivals celebrating artistry and culture.
